Additional Services
Diabetic Care
This community offers diabetes care and can offer insulin injections, including sliding scale therapy.
Incontinence Care
Incontinent residents must be able to manage incontinence themselves. This staff at this community can remind incontinent residents to use the restroom. This community can care for residents with bowel incontinence. This community can care for residents with bladder incontinence.
Non Ambulatory Care
This community can provide a 2 person assisted transfer for residents who need help transferring, for example, from a bed into a wheelchair.
Other Care
This community provides multiple levels of care allowing residents to remain at the community while receiving increasing care.

reviewed on: 12/13/2017 by AnonymousThings are going good here and my parents are settling in well. The facility has a few different activities the residents can participate in like bingo, cards, and dominoes. The food is good and I personally like it better than another place they were at. They can get as little or as much of it as they want. The building is kept pretty clean and housekeeping comes by once a week to clean their bedding and towels. The staff has been very friendly and I haven’t had any problems with them. They even have a 24 hour nurse. Overall, I would recommend them to others.
